For the most recent academic year available, 16% of non-professional legal studies bachelor’s degrees went to men and 84% went to women.
The largest share of non-professional legal studies bachelor’s degree graduates at David Lipscomb University David Lipscomb Lipscomb are White. Approximately 58%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Lipscomb University with a bachelor’s in non-professional legal studies.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 0 |
| Black or African American | 5 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 2 |
| White | 11 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 1 |
